What is Sleep Paralysis
Sleep paralysis is a phenomenon that occurs during sleep, in which the individual experiences temporary paralysis along with a sense of being awake and unable to move or speak. It is a condition that affects the body’s ability to transition smoothly between different stages of sleep, particularly in the moments of transitioning between sleep and wakefulness.
Definition
Sleep paralysis can be defined as a state of temporary muscle paralysis that occurs during sleep or upon awakening from sleep. It is categorized as a parasomnia, a type of sleep disorder that involves abnormal behaviors or experiences during sleep. During an episode of sleep paralysis, the individual may be fully conscious and aware of their surroundings, but they are unable to move their limbs, despite their efforts to do so.
Prevalence
Sleep paralysis is a relatively common occurrence, with studies suggesting that about 7.6% of the general population has experienced at least one episode of sleep paralysis in their lifetime. However, the frequency and severity of episodes can vary among individuals. It appears to be more prevalent among certain populations, such as young adults and individuals with sleep disorders.
Causes
The exact causes of sleep paralysis are not fully understood. However, it is believed to involve a disruption in the normal sleep cycle and the transitions between sleep stages. Sleep paralysis is often associated with other sleep disorders, such as narcolepsy, insomnia, and sleep apnea. It can also be triggered by certain lifestyle factors, such as sleep deprivation, irregular sleep schedules, and high levels of stress or anxiety.
Symptoms of Sleep Paralysis
Sleep paralysis is characterized by several distinct symptoms, which can vary in intensity and duration from person to person. These symptoms can be grouped into three main categories: incapacitation, hallucinations, and fear/anxiety.
Incapacitation
The primary symptom of sleep paralysis is the temporary inability to move or speak. This paralysis is often accompanied by a sensation of pressure on the chest, which can lead to difficulty breathing. Individuals may also experience a sense of heaviness or weight on their body, making any attempt to move even more challenging.
Hallucinations
Another common symptom of sleep paralysis is the presence of hallucinations. These hallucinations can be visual, auditory, or tactile in nature. Visual hallucinations often involve the perception of shadowy figures, strange beings, or distorted shapes in the room. Auditory hallucinations may manifest as whispers, buzzing sounds, or voices speaking directly to the individual. Tactile hallucinations can include the sensation of being touched, grabbed, or pulled by an unseen force.
Fear and Anxiety
Sleep paralysis episodes can induce intense fear and anxiety in individuals. The combination of paralysis, hallucinations, and a feeling of being trapped can lead to a sense of impending doom or a fear of imminent danger. Some individuals may also experience a sense of detachment from their body or an out-of-body experience, further heightening their anxiety.

The Sleep Paralysis Experience
Understanding the stages and the individual components of the sleep paralysis experience can shed light on the mechanisms underlying this phenomenon.
Entering Sleep Paralysis
Sleep paralysis typically occurs during the rapid eye movement (REM) stage of sleep, as the body transitions from a state of deep sleep to a state of wakefulness. During REM sleep, dreaming occurs, and the brain sends signals to inhibit muscle movement, effectively immobilizing the body to prevent acting out dreams. However, when an individual experiences sleep paralysis, this temporary paralysis continues even as they become conscious, leading to a state of feeling awake but unable to move.
Hallucinatory Phase
The hallucinatory phase of sleep paralysis is characterized by the perception of vivid and often unsettling hallucinations. These hallucinations can range from seeing shadowy figures in the room to hearing voices or feeling a presence in the vicinity. The hallucinatory experiences can be so realistic that individuals may have difficulty distinguishing them from reality, leading to a heightened sense of fear and anxiety.
Exiting Sleep Paralysis
Exiting sleep paralysis can occur spontaneously, as the body naturally transitions out of the REM stage of sleep. However, individuals can also try to actively break out of the paralyzed state by attempting to move their fingers or toes, and gradually regain control over their body. It is important to note that the transition out of sleep paralysis can be accompanied by a sense of relief, but individuals may still feel lingering anxiety or fear from the experience.

Distinguishing Sleep Paralysis from Other Sleep Disorders
Sleep paralysis can share similarities with other sleep disorders, especially in terms of the symptoms experienced during the episodes. However, there are certain key distinctions that can help differentiate sleep paralysis from these other conditions.
Nightmares
While sleep paralysis episodes can involve vivid and unsettling hallucinations, it is important to note that not all nightmares are indicative of sleep paralysis. Nightmares typically occur during REM sleep, but do not involve the paralysis experienced in sleep paralysis. In nightmares, individuals can often move, speak, or even wake themselves up from the dream.
REM Sleep Behavior Disorder
REM sleep behavior disorder (RBD) is a sleep disorder characterized by individuals physically acting out their dreams, often with violent movements and vocalizations. Unlike sleep paralysis, RBD involves the absence of paralysis during REM sleep. Individuals with RBD may exhibit disruptive and potentially dangerous behaviors while asleep, which is distinct from the immobility experienced in sleep paralysis.
Narcolepsy
Narcolepsy is a neurological disorder characterized by excessive daytime sleepiness, sudden and uncontrollable episodes of falling asleep, and disrupted sleep patterns. While sleep paralysis can occur in individuals with narcolepsy, it is not solely indicative of the disorder. Other symptoms, such as cataplexy (sudden, temporary loss of muscle control) and excessive daytime sleepiness, are typically present in individuals with narcolepsy.
Cataplexy
Cataplexy is a condition characterized by sudden and temporary loss of muscle control, typically triggered by strong emotions such as laughter or anger. Although sleep paralysis and cataplexy can occur together in individuals with narcolepsy, sleep paralysis can also occur independently and is not always accompanied by cataplexy.

Famous Cases of Sleep Paralysis
Throughout history, there have been numerous accounts of individuals experiencing sleep paralysis, often described in various cultural, religious, or supernatural contexts. While it is impossible to definitively determine whether these accounts were indeed sleep paralysis episodes, they provide insights into the historical and cultural significance of this phenomenon.
Historical Cases
One of the most well-known historical cases of sleep paralysis is the painting “The Nightmare” by Henry Fuseli, created in 1781. The painting depicts a woman lying in bed, seemingly paralyzed, with a demonic creature sitting on her chest. This depiction mirrors the sensations experienced during sleep paralysis episodes and has become an iconic representation of the condition.
